Skip to content

Remove modelRouter and add model_providers concept #803

Remove modelRouter and add model_providers concept

Remove modelRouter and add model_providers concept #803

Triggered via pull request January 21, 2026 12:57
Status Failure
Total duration 1m 8s
Artifacts

checks.yaml

on: pull_request
Fit to window
Zoom out
Zoom in

Annotations

10 errors
Ruff (E501): src/askui/models/fallback_model.py#L183
src/askui/models/fallback_model.py:183:89: E501 Line too long (94 > 88)
Ruff (E501): src/askui/models/fallback_model.py#L179
src/askui/models/fallback_model.py:179:89: E501 Line too long (97 > 88)
Ruff (BLE001): src/askui/models/fallback_model.py#L105
src/askui/models/fallback_model.py:105:20: BLE001 Do not catch blind exception: `Exception`
Ruff (PERF203): src/askui/models/fallback_model.py#L105
src/askui/models/fallback_model.py:105:13: PERF203 `try`-`except` within a loop incurs performance overhead
Ruff (TRY300): src/askui/models/fallback_model.py#L104
src/askui/models/fallback_model.py:104:17: TRY300 Consider moving this statement to an `else` block
Ruff (E501): src/askui/models/askui/models.py#L204
src/askui/models/askui/models.py:204:89: E501 Line too long (94 > 88)
Ruff (E501): src/askui/models/askui/models.py#L175
src/askui/models/askui/models.py:175:89: E501 Line too long (89 > 88)
Ruff (E501): src/askui/model_store/__init__.py#L84
src/askui/model_store/__init__.py:84:89: E501 Line too long (106 > 88)
Ruff (E501): src/askui/data_extractor.py#L21
src/askui/data_extractor.py:21:89: E501 Line too long (95 > 88)
Ruff (E501): src/askui/agent_base.py#L112
src/askui/agent_base.py:112:89: E501 Line too long (89 > 88)